OPORD 06: "OPERATION EQUILIBRE"
LÉGIO PATRIA NOSTRA
GTIA "LÉGION" / PCIAT HQ: BOA NAPOLEON DTG: [DATE REDACTED]
OPORD 06: "OPERATION EQUILIBRE - SOUTHERN SHIELD"
REFERENCES: A. Map Series: KUNAR_VALLEY_50K_V2 B. AAR OP 05 (Sangar Sweep)
TIME ZONE: ZULU
1. SITUATION
A. General (Situation Générale)
Following the destruction of the insurgent mechanized battalion in the Sangar Valley, the Eastern flank (Zaymur River) is stable. However, an insurgent pocket remains in the Khoran Rud valley, specifically in and around the village of KHUNBAR (bypassed during OP 03). Neutralizing this pocket will completely secure the southernmost grid sector (Korengal River - Khoran Rud - Zaymur River), eliminating the threat of a southern flank attack on our MSRs.
Cave Complex (West of Khunbar): Intelligence indicates a suspected insurgent hideout/supply cache in the cave networks West of Khunbar. Status: Unconfirmed strength, highly defensible.
Korangal Valley Defenders: Entrenched insurgent forces located at Ali Abad, Kandlay, COP Korangal (Insurgent Held), and Firebase Vegas. These elements control the entrance to the Korangal River Valley.
C. Friendly Forces (AMIS)
GREEN 1 (Section Vert 1): Main Maneuver & Assault Element.
NOIR 5-1 (2 REP): Attached Sniper/Fire Support Element.
OP MURAT: Operational. Providing overwatch on the North-Western Tora-Sayyad river approach.
Air Assets: Due to the destruction of enemy mobile AA in OP 05, Close Air Support (CAS) via Rotary and Fixed-Wing assets is now AVAILABLE and on-station.
2. MISSION
GREEN 1 and attached elements are to CLEAR the village of Khunbar and the adjacent cave complex in order to secure the Southern flank. BE PREPARED TO (BPT) transition to the North to SEIZE Ali Abad, COP Korangal, Kandlay, and Firebase Vegas to secure the entrance of the Korangal River Valley.
3. EXECUTION
A. Commander's Intent
My intent is to permanently seal the southern battlespace. By clearing the Khoran Rud valley, we deny the enemy their last staging ground in the South. Once secured, and assuming combat effectiveness remains high, we will exploit this momentum to kick the door in on the Korangal Valley. We will leverage our newly regained air superiority to soften hardened targets before infantry assaults.
B. Concept of Operations
The operation will be conducted in two phases:
PHASE 1: SECURING KHORAN RUD (Main Effort)
Support by Fire:NOIR 5-1 will infiltrate and establish a high-altitude sniper/overwatch position on the mountain ridgeline between BOA Napoleon and Khunbar.
Task: Provide early warning, overwatch, and precision elimination of high-value targets in Khunbar.
Assault:GREEN 1 will advance into the Khoran Rud valley.
Objective 1: Investigate, isolate, and clear the suspected Cave Complex West of Khunbar. Expect CQB (Close Quarters Battle) and booby traps.
Objective 2: Assault and clear KHUNBAR village.
End State (Phase 1): Khoran Rud valley is completely clear. The Southern Grid is 100% secured.
PHASE 2: KORANGAL GATE (Conditional / On Order)
Trigger: Phase 1 successfully completed; Green 1 reports high combat effectiveness; PCIAT authorizes advance.
Maneuver: Green 1 displaces North towards the Korangal River Valley entrance.
Assault Sequence:
Clear the village of ALI ABAD (previously aborted in OP 02).
Assault and seize the insurgent-held COP KORANGAL and adjacent KANDLAY village.
Assault and secure FIREBASE VEGAS.
Overwatch:OP MURAT will monitor the Tora-Sayyad river axis to prevent any enemy flanking maneuvers from the Northwest.
Air Support: Rotary CAS will provide heavy suppression on Firebase Vegas and COP Korangal prior to the Green 1 ground assault.
C. Coordinating Instructions
Cave Clearance Protocol: Do not commit the entire platoon into subterranean environments. Utilize explosives/flashbangs and clear methodically. If the cave network is too extensive, designate for combat engineer demolition (MINEX) at a later date.
ROE:RESTRICTIVE. Civilians expected in Khunbar, Ali Abad and Kandlay.
All civilians are to be detained (Prisoners) and moved to the rear (CP Arcole -> BOA Napoleon).
No unobserved indirect fire into the town center unless troops are in extremis.
Fire Support:
GBUs: Priority to confirmed Armor (T-72/BMP).
Mortars: 81mm/120mm available on call.
Prisoner Handling: Green 1-0 designates PCP. Extraction by Green Command logistics.
CAS Integration: Green 1-0 is designated as the primary JTAC (Joint Terminal Attack Controller) on the ground.
4. SERVICE SUPPORT (LOGISTIQUE)
A. Supply
Rations: 24hrs on person.
Ammo: Basic load. Extra 5.56mm and 7.62mm linked available via vehicle resupply.
Water: Critical. 3L per man minimum.
Vehicle Recovery: VBCIs are self-recovering where possible; heavy recovery assets at BOA Napoleon on standby.
B. Medical
CCP (Casualty Collection Point): TBD by medical team.
Role 1: embedded with Green 1-0.
Role 2: BOA Napoleon Medical Station.
MEDEVAC:
Category A (Urgent): Launch Scramble.
Category B (Priority): Ground convoy if road is clear.
MEDEVAC via Rotary Wing is GREEN/CLEARED.
C. Prisoners
A collection point will be established near OP Murat.
